Boost Your Fitness: Why an Elliptical is Essential

Stepping onto an elliptical trainer isn't just about getting your heart rate up; it's a gateway to transforming your overall fitness. This low-impact exercise machine provides a full-body workout that targets major muscle groups, from your legs and core to your arms and back. One of the biggest benefits of the elliptical is its gentle nature on your joints. Unlike high-impact activities like running or jumping, the smooth, gliding motion minimizes stress on your knees, hips, and ankles, making it a perfect choice for people of all fitness levels, including those with pre-existing conditions.

  • Moreover, elliptical training offers incredible cardiovascular advantages. It effectively raises your heart rate, improving your stamina and lung capacity.
  • The adjustable resistance levels allow you to tailor your workout intensity, ensuring a challenging and effective experience every time.
  • Therefore, incorporating an elliptical trainer into your fitness routine is a decision that will reap lasting rewards for your health and well-being.

Treadmill Training Towards Your Fitness Goals

Embarking on a fitness journey can be both exciting and daunting. Choosing the right approach is crucial for achieving your goals. For many individuals, the treadmill emerges as a popular tool. Whether you're a seasoned runner or just starting your fitness adventure, treadmill training offers a predictable environment to boost your cardiovascular health and overall well-being.

Several benefits come with incorporating treadmill workouts into your routine. Initially, it provides a steady pace, allowing you to monitor your progress effectively. Secondly, treadmills often feature built-in programs that can customize your workouts according your fitness level and objectives. Ultimately, the controlled environment shields you from fluctuating weather conditions, ensuring a reliable training experience.

  • For the purpose of maximize your treadmill workouts, consider including interval training into your routine.
  • Test with different incline levels to challenge your muscles and improve calorie burn.
  • Listen to your body and change your workout intensity as needed.

Cardio with a Cross Trainer: Low Impact to Fitness

A cross trainer is an exceptional choice for individuals seeking a low-impact training regimen. It provides a full-body challenge while minimizing stress on your joints. Engaging both your arms and legs in a smooth, rhythmic movement, the cross trainer helps improve your heart fitness level.

  • The low-impact nature of cross trainer workouts makes it ideal for individuals of all fitness levels.
  • You can easily adjust the intensity by altering the resistance and speed.
  • Burn calories while strengthening your muscles.

Incorporating cross trainer cardio into your weekly routine can lead to significant improvements in your overall health and fitness.

Finding the Perfect Cardio Machine for Your Fitness Aspirations

Embarking on a fitness journey often demands selecting the right cardio machine. With an overwhelming variety of options available, from treadmills to ellipticals and stationary bikes, choosing the ideal one can feel daunting. However, by considering your personal fitness goals and preferences, you can confidently navigate this selection process. First, establish your top fitness goal. Are you hoping to boost your cardiovascular health, lose weight, or build muscle? Once you have a clear understanding of your objectives, you can refine your search based on machine types that best cater with your aspirations.

  • Think about the area available in your home or gym. A large treadmill may not be suitable for a small apartment, while a compact elliptical could be perfect.
  • Research different brands and models, reading reviews and comparing features to discover the best value for your money.
  • Prioritize features that are essential to you, such as incline options, heart rate monitoring, or built-in workout programs.

Remember, the best cardio machine is the one you will genuinely use consistently. Choose a machine that you find enjoyable to operate and motivates you to stay active.
